Kwara LG inaugurates 5-man committee to boost IGR

Date: 2018-07-19

Hon. Muyiwa Oladipo, the Chairman of Irepodun Local Government Area (LGA) of Kwara on Tuesday says that the newly inaugurated task force committee on Internally Generated Revue (IGR) was to achieve an all inclusive growth in the council

Oladipo made assertion while inaugurating the 5-man task force committee members at the council Secretariat in Omu-Aran.

Oladipo who noted that the era of relying solely on funds from Federation Account was gone for good, expressed confidence in the ability of the committee members to deliver in their assignment.

He said that the inauguration of the committee was also informed by the need to boost the council's revenue profile and fast track its socio-economic development.

The council boss charged the committee member to exhibit honesty, diligence and transparency in the discharge of their responsibilities.

Oladipo, while emphasising the need for the members work with relevant stakeholders to ease their assignment also assured them of the council maximum support in achieving their mandate and target.

"Inaugurating this all important committee cannot be better than now when our people are yearnings for improve welfare and better living condition.

"We are optimistic that the committee will work assiduously to block revenue leakages and loopholes to boost our revenue target for an all inclusive growth.

It is, therefore, in the light of this fact that I call on the good people of the council across various communities to give the committee the needed support to succeed," he said.

The News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) reports that the committee which is headed by Mr Yinka Adenigba, the council's Area Revenue Officer, also included the council's Secretary, Mr Agboola Olayemi as member.

Adenigba while responding on behalf of members thanked the council for the opportunity given to them to serve.

He pledged that the committee would explore every available avenues and resources for timely achievement of its aims and objectives. (NAN)
